<html lang="ja-jp" dir="ltr"><head></head><body>### [AutoptimizeでのWPForms最適化設定の設定方法](https://wpforms.com/docs/configuring-optimization-settings-for-wpforms-in-autoptimize/)

**公開日:** 2024年6月17日
**著者:** Umair Majeed

**抜粋:** Autoptimizeの設定を調整してWPFormsとの競合を防ぐ方法を学びましょう。

**コンテンツ:**

Autoptimizeの最適化設定によりWPFormsで問題が発生していませんか？多くのサイト所有者は、サイトを高速化するために最適化およびキャッシュプラグインを使用しています。しかし、これらのプラグインに含まれる一部の機能は、WPFormsの機能が正しく動作しない原因となることがあります。

このガイドでは、WPFormsがスムーズに動作するようにAutoptimizeの設定を調整する方法を説明します。

- [Autoptimizeの設定の調整](#wp-rocket)
    - [WPFormsアセットの除外](#assets)
    - [JavaScriptの最適化の無効化](#disable-javascript)

---

## Autoptimizeの設定の調整

[Autoptimize ](https://wordpress.org/plugins/autoptimize/)プラグインでは、**JavaScriptコードの最適化**オプションが、多くの場合フォームの問題を引き起こすことがわかっています。

Autoptimizeがサイトで有効になっているときにフォームが期待どおりに動作せず、[JavaScriptの問題を特定した](https://wpforms.com/docs/how-to-troubleshoot-javascript-issues-in-wpforms/#identifying-js-issues)場合は、次の手順を試すことができます。

#### WPFormsアセットの除外

Autoptimizeの設定内で、WPFormsアセットをJavaScriptの最適化から除外できます。これを行うには、まず**設定 » Autoptimize**に移動する必要があります。

![Autoptimize settings](https://wpforms.com/wp-content/uploads/2021/10/autoptimize-settings.png)次に、**JS、CSS &amp; HTML**タブで、**Autoptimizeからスクリプトを除外**セクションまでスクロールします。このフィールドに、WPFormsアセットを除外するために次のスクリプトを追加します。

`/wp-content/plugins/wpforms/assets/js/frontend/wpforms.min.js`

**注意:** デフォルトでは、Autoptimizeは一部の除外されたスクリプトを**Autoptimizeからスクリプトを除外**フィールドに自動的に追加します。このフィールドにスクリプトを手動で追加する場合は、各スクリプトをコンマで区切るようにしてください。

![Exclude scripts from Autoptimize](https://wpforms.com/wp-content/uploads/2024/10/exclude-scripts-from-autoptimize-1.png)次に、**その他のオプション**セクションまでスクロールし、**除外されたCSSおよびJSファイルを最小化しますか？**オプションの横にあるチェックボックスをオフにします。

![Minify CSS and JS Autoptimize](https://wpforms.com/wp-content/uploads/2021/10/minify-css-js-autoptimize.png)**注意:** このオプションは、**JavaScriptオプション**セクションで**JSファイルを集約する**オプションがチェックされている場合にのみ表示されます。

準備ができたら、ページの下部にある**変更を保存してキャッシュを空にする**ボタンをクリックして設定を保存してください。

![Save changes and empty cache button](https://wpforms.com/wp-content/uploads/2021/10/save-changes-and-empty-cache-button.png)#### JavaScriptの最適化の無効化

WPFormsアセットを除外しても問題が解決しない場合は、**JavaScriptコードの最適化**オプションを無効にする必要があります。

これを行うには、**JS、CSS &amp; HTML**ページの先頭までスクロールし、**JavaScriptコードを最適化しますか？**の横にあるチェックボックスをオフにします。

![Disable optimize javascript code](https://wpforms.com/wp-content/uploads/2021/10/disable-optimize-javascript-code.png)次に、**変更を保存してキャッシュを空にする**ボタンをクリックして設定を保存します。

![Save changes and empty cache button](https://wpforms.com/wp-content/uploads/2021/10/save-changes-and-empty-cache-button.png)これで完了です！これで、WPFormsとの競合を防ぐためにAutoptimizeの設定を調整する方法がわかりました。

次に、WPFormsでのJavaScriptエラーのトラブルシューティングについてさらに詳しく知りたいですか？詳細については、[JavaScriptエラーのトラブルシューティング](https://wpforms.com/docs/how-to-troubleshoot-javascript-issues-in-wpforms/)ガイドを確認してください。

**カテゴリ:** トラブルシューティング、トラブルシューティングとサポート

---</body></html>